Ledger on The Joker & Bale: No To The Same "Old Road"
Author: Jett
Monday, September 11, 2006 - 10:17 AM: Heath Ledger actually "F'n HATES" comic book movies, but he digs The Joker. Read more (via DARK HORIZONS:

"I actually hate comic book movies, like f***ing hate them, they just bore me sh**less and they're just dumb. But I thought what Chris Nolan did with [BATMAN BEGINS] was actually really good, really well directed, and Christian Bale was really great in it."

"He's going to be really sinister and it's going to be less about his laugh and his pranks and more about just him being a just a f***ing sinister guy."

[Asked if he decides to do a big movie like this, because of agent pressure.] "I'm sure they're super happy that I'm doing this [THE DARK KNIGHT], because this is the first time I've really kind of taken something like that, so they're over the moon. But I think it's just going to be a really fun experience, and I love to dress up and wear a mask."

[How will his Joker look?] "I've seen a few interesting designs on the look and I think that it's going to look pretty cool."
